Wie lautet ein SQL Beispiel mit unbekannten Zeichen, damit Oracle umgekehrte Fragezeichen als Lösung anzeigt?

Antwort

In Oracle SQL kannst du Platzhalterzeichen wie den Unterstrich (`_`) und das Prozentzeichen (`%`) verwenden, um unbekannte Zeichen in einer Abfrage zu repräsentieren. Der Unterstrich steht für genau ein beliebiges Zeichen, während das Prozentzeichen für null oder mehr beliebige Zeichen steht. Hier ist ein Beispiel, wie du eine Abfrage mit unbekannten Zeichen erstellen kannst: ```sql SELECT * FROM deine_tabelle WHERE deine_spalte LIKE 'A_B%'; ``` In diesem Beispiel: - `A_B%` bedeutet, dass die gesuchten Werte in `deine_spalte` mit einem 'A' beginnen, gefolgt von einem beliebigen Zeichen (repräsentiert durch `_`), dann einem 'B' und schließlich null oder mehr beliebigen Zeichen (repräsentiert durch `%`). Wenn du speziell nach umgekehrten Fragezeichen suchst, kannst du diese direkt in der Abfrage verwenden: ```sql SELECT * FROM deine_tabelle WHERE deine_spalte LIKE '%¿%'; ``` In diesem Beispiel: - `%¿%` bedeutet, dass die gesuchten Werte in `deine_spalte` irgendwo ein umgekehrtes Fragezeichen (`¿`) enthalten, umgeben von null oder mehr beliebigen Zeichen. Weitere Informationen zu Oracle SQL findest du in der offiziellen Dokumentation: [Oracle SQL Documentation](https://docs.oracle.com/en/database/oracle/oracle-database/19/sqlrf/index.html).

Frage stellen und sofort Antwort erhalten

Verwandte Fragen

Wie erstellt man in VSCode eigene ASCII-Zeichen?

Um in Visual Studio Code (VSCode) eigene ASCII-Zeichen oder ASCII-Art zu erstellen, kannst du einfach den integrierten Editor nutzen. Hier sind die Schritte: 1. **Neue Datei anlegen:** Öffn... [mehr]

Wie erstellt man ein PHP-Anmeldeformular mit SQL-Datenbankanbindung, das nach Eingabe eines Zugangscodes zugänglich ist?

Um ein Anmeldeformular in PHP bereitzustellen, das erst nach Eingabe eines Zugangscodes sichtbar wird, benötigst du zwei Schritte: 1. **Code-Eingabe-Formular**: Nutzer geben einen Zugangscode ei... [mehr]

Gibt es in VB.NET 2003 einen Unterschied zwischen '.PadLeft(2, Convert.ToChar("0"))' und '.PadLeft(2, "0"c)'?

Ja, es gibt einen kleinen, aber wichtigen Unterschied zwischen `.PadLeft(2, Convert.ToChar("0"))` und `.PadLeft(2, "0"c)` in VB.NET 2003: **1. `.PadLeft(2, Convert.ToChar("0&... [mehr]